Output 8de9629eba8d02bae50d7efa77c533d2ae7d73436481893f6e62c23b99cd4197:0

value
6431687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f638f57100ca47d0de0158e72e2584896b071b OP_EQUAL
address
3DYC48RQRcZTfYoA1PzcqWfmcTofyyoCWx
transaction
8de9629eba8d02bae50d7efa77c533d2ae7d73436481893f6e62c23b99cd4197
spent
true